Rosemary Dinner Rolls

     These were heavenly, not that I would know much about that. But I would recommend making these at least once a week. I am convinced they are good for your soul. 

Drizzle oil (any kind) in cast iron pan



Smooth oil all over pan with paper towel

So it looks like this


I made me own but you can use any store bought unbaked bread rolls

Cover for at least 2 hours and let rise

     Here is where I got distracted. Before you put them in the oven chop fresh rosemary. Brush rolls with butter. Sprinkle chopped rosemary and course sea salt over the rolls and bake at 400 until brown like these babies.
Add more butter!

EAT!
